    7550ci Black blotches

    Suggestions please...

    Customer has a 7550ci, getting series of black oval/blotches randomly (not every page) at trail end only, 11x17 100lb Text paper, duplexed (mostly only on first page printed, occasionally on second side)

    Have changed black charge roller, secondary transfer roller (improved issue but not resolved), replaced complete vertical path (pull out door) all to no resolution... have not seen this on 11x8 1/2 paper at all7550.pdf

    Re: 7550ci Black blotches

    What do the fuser inlet guides look like? Perhaps the curl of the paper is dragging the unfused image across the fuser inlet guide.

    I agree that it looks a little like a charge problem, but I don't think it is. =^..^=

    Re: 7550ci Black blotches

    There's a bulletin on it from February 2015. called 2LC-0108 (D024) "Measure against the Vertical Black Streak". Apply that for 7550ci and you should be ok. Also, make sure you have the latest firmware on it.
